    Pushbutton high idle?

    Got a bit of an unusual idea, vehicle is 66 ford f500, 2001 5.3l attached to original ford 4spd manual.

    It has a hydraulic pto drive that operates a dump box. On the original engine I had a cable operated high idle that helped give needed rpms for the pto.

    Would it be possible to wire a switch to ac compressor input on ecm, and have a push button high idle?

    Sure thing. It'll just think the AC is on and increase the idle speed to the commanded "AC on" speed.
